Logarithmic Correlation Functions in Liouville Field Theory

Abstract
We study four-point correlation functions with logarithmic behaviour in Liouville field theory on a sphere, which consist of one kind of the local operators. We study them as non-integrated correlation functions of the gravitational sector of two-dimensional quantum gravity coupled to an ordinary conformal field theory in the conformal gauge. We also examine, in the (p,q) minimal conformal field theories, a condition of the appearance of logarithmic correlation functions of gravitationally dressed operators.
